From the Planning Commission to NITI Aayog
India adopted centralised Five Year Plans as its main development-planning instrument starting in 1951, a model borrowed from the Soviet planning tradition and administered by the Planning Commission, a body set up in 1950 that set national targets and allocated resources to states largely top-down, on broadly the same terms for every state regardless of its own specific starting conditions. This model ran through twelve successive plans until 2017. On 1 January 2015, the Union Government formally replaced the Planning Commission with NITI Aayog (National Institution for Transforming India), a change announced by the Prime Minister the preceding Independence Day. The shift is worth stating precisely rather than as a simple rename, since the two bodies work on genuinely different logic: NITI Aayog functions as a policy think tank offering strategic and technical advice rather than allocating plan funds directly, and it is built explicitly around cooperative federalism, involving states as active partners in setting their own development priorities rather than receiving a uniform, centrally-set target, the specific contrast between the two models' respective planning philosophies that this chapter tests directly.
Sustainable development: balancing growth against ecological limits
Sustainable development is generally understood, following the definition popularised by the Brundtland Commission, as development that meets the needs of the present generation without compromising the ability of future generations to meet their own needs, and Indian planning has increasingly had to weigh this principle against the pressure to grow output and infrastructure quickly. The tension is not abstract: several of India's own large-scale development projects have delivered real economic gains alongside real, sometimes severe, ecological costs, which is exactly why this chapter is built around a specific case study rather than the principle in the abstract.
Case study: the Indira Gandhi Canal and the Thar Desert
The Indira Gandhi Canal, India's longest irrigation canal, carries water from the Harike Barrage in Punjab across the international border of dry western Rajasthan, built specifically to convert the arid, sparsely cultivable Thar Desert into productive farmland through large-scale irrigation. The canal succeeded at that immediate goal, visibly greening large tracts of what had been desert and supporting new agricultural settlement across the command area. But the same irrigation created a serious, unintended ecological problem: much of western Rajasthan's subsoil carries an impermeable hard layer of gypsum or calcite that blocks water from draining downward, so heavy, continuous canal irrigation raised the water table until it sat close to the surface across large areas, a condition called waterlogging. Once the water table rises that close to the surface, capillary action then draws groundwater, and the salts dissolved within it, back up toward the topsoil, a process called salinisation, which degrades the very land the canal was meant to make productive, in the more severe cases rendering it unfit for cultivation altogether. The case is the standing example this chapter uses precisely because it shows sustainable development's core tension in miniature: a project can deliver its intended development outcome in full and still undermine its own long-term sustainability through an ecological side effect the original design did not anticipate, and the recommended fixes, integrated drainage systems, bio-drainage through targeted afforestation to lower the water table naturally, and more efficient irrigation technique to reduce the volume of water applied in the first place, are explicitly about correcting that specific mechanism rather than abandoning irrigation altogether.
Quick revision points
- Five Year Plans ran from 1951 through 2017 (twelve plans), administered by the Planning Commission (established 1950), a centralised, largely top-down model.
- NITI Aayog replaced the Planning Commission on 1 January 2015; it functions as a policy think tank built around cooperative federalism (states as active partners in setting priorities) rather than a central fund-allocating body issuing uniform targets.
- Sustainable development: meeting present needs without compromising future generations' ability to meet their own (the Brundtland Commission's definition).
- Indira Gandhi Canal (Harike Barrage, Punjab, to western Rajasthan): India's longest irrigation canal, built to convert the Thar Desert into farmland; succeeded at that goal but caused waterlogging (an impermeable gypsum/calcite hard pan blocks drainage) and consequent salinisation (capillary action draws saline groundwater to the surface), degrading the land it irrigated.
- Recommended fixes: integrated drainage systems, bio-drainage via targeted afforestation to lower the water table, and more efficient irrigation technique, rather than abandoning canal irrigation.
